Quantum Entanglement Just Got "Big"

The "big" news of the week so far is the two papers published in nature that increased the size of entities that can be in an quantum entanglement.

It looks like we've approached the size of a human hair, which, by any quantum mechanical standards, is humongous.

This is beginning to approach the the scale size of the Schrodinger Cat. Well, not quite, but it is in the right direction. The Schrodinger Cat-type states, which is more of a demonstration of quantum superposition (and a vital ingredient in quantum entanglement), is also getting to be huge.
